I have a decent plan in place, which consists of essentially selling everything I have acquired this far, and moving to an area that is cheaper and that I truly enjoy and envy. You can read my previous posts. However my concern is this, I’ve been so conditioned to be as aggressive as I can in life in order to make it. For example, the “smarter” thing to do would be to simple rent my current house and collect roughly $2500 per month instead of selling it outright. Also people will argue that I shouldn’t but my next house in a cheaper area outright. I should have a mortgage to maximize my tax advantage, and I could use that money for other higher yielding assets. Blah blah blah.

My question is, how do I convince myself that living a more simple life, with let’s say no mortgage, is what I need in life. I know life is short and if I can live without debt and without as much stress that’s going to give me the life I want .

My plan is to work, but as my own boss and on my own schedule, let’s say part time.
